Harrison man arrested after high-speed chase in Maine and New Hampshire

A 44-year-old Harrison resident was arrested early this morning after a chase involving both New Hampshire and Maine police.

According to a statement, New Hampshire State Police were trying to stop a pickup truck driven by Matthew Olsen just after midnight. Olsen had reportedly refused to stop for a local police department and rammed a cruiser during the pursuit.

After crossing over the border to Maine on I-95 northbound, Maine State Troopers eventually managed to stop him near the rest area in Kennebunk due to his tires getting damaged after driving over a curb.

Olsen was arrested on multiple charges including Operating Under the Influence. He’s since been taken to York County Jail, though not before being taken to a local hospital as a precaution.
